Bottenberg
Bottenberg is a village in Freudenberg, Siegen-Wittgenstein, North Rhine-Westphalia. Bottenberg is situated nearby to the locality Anstoß, as well as near the village Büschergrund.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Freudenberg
Town
Photo: Schizoschaf,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Freudenberg is a town in the Siegen-Wittgenstein district, in North Rhine-Westphalia, Germany. The town lies on the German-Dutch holiday road called the Orange Route, joining towns, cities and regions associated with the House of Orange.
